to clear things up...

 

Mass participation ride is on sunday 28th, Pedal for Scotland, from Edinburgh to Glasgow.

 

Elite crit is on monday 29th, evening

 

TOB starts 30th

 

 

However there may be an 'Etape du Tour of Britain' on part of the 1st stage route.....watch this space :grin:
